Article Ecology

Archaeal extracellular vesicles are produced in an ESCRT-dependent manner and promote gene transfer and nutrient cycling in extreme environments

Junfeng Liu et al.

Summary: Membrane-bound extracellular vesicles (EVs) are secreted by cells from all three domains of life, carrying a diverse proteome and DNA, and can support bacterial growth in extreme environments. The production of EVs in bacteria is mediated by the ESCRT machinery, with a prime role of ESCRT-III-1 and ESCRT-III-2 proteins in EV budding. EVs have deep evolutionary roots and play a crucial role in horizontal gene transfer and nutrient cycling in extreme environments.

Article Multidisciplinary Sciences

Virus-induced cell gigantism and asymmetric cell division in archaea

Junfeng Liu et al.

Summary: Archaeal virus STSV2 interferes with the cell cycle of its host Sulfolobus islandicus, leading to giant cell formation and asymmetric division. The CRISPR-Cas system plays a key role in defending against the virus. This study sheds light on how archaeal viruses manipulate host cells.

Article Microbiology

CdrS Is a Global Transcriptional Regulator Influencing Cell Division in Haloferax volcanii

Yan Liao et al.

Summary: The transcription factor CdrS plays a central role in coordinating metabolism and cell division in the archaeon Haloferax volcanii. It regulates the expression of genes associated with cell division, protein degradation, and metabolism. Additionally, CdrS has multiple DNA-binding sites and is involved in the regulation of essential cell division genes, suggesting its sophisticated role in coordinating cellular pathways.
